企业场景-网站目录安全权限深度讲解及umask知识
摘要:站点目录的文件和目录给什么权限: 默认权限是安全权限的临界点,工作中尽量给这个临界点,或者小于临界点,不要大于临界点权限。 默认权限分配的命令 umask 在linux下文件的默认权限是由umask值决定的 问题1:为什么默认权限目录755,文件644而不是其他的值呢? 1)简单好用的加减法计算 对
阅读全文
posted @
2019-09-28 09:44
Jiekon
阅读(147)
推荐(0)
linux文件权限更改命令chmod及数字权限实践总结
摘要:改变权限属性命令chmod chmod 是用来改变文件或目录权限的命令,但只有文件的属主和超级用户root才有这种权限。通过chmod来改变文件或目录的权限有两种方法:一种是通过权限字母和操作符表达式的方法来设置权限;另一种是使用数字方法(常用)设置权限。下面分别进行介绍。 1) chmod 数字权
阅读全文
posted @
2019-09-27 14:57
Jiekon
阅读(788)
推荐(0)
linux系统目录权限实践及结论
摘要:总结测试结论:Linux目录的读、写、执行权限说明:
阅读全文
posted @
2019-09-27 10:56
Jiekon
阅读(122)
推荐(0)
Linux文件权限实践
摘要:用户测试准备: 如果dongdaxia用户存在的话就用下面修改用户组的命令 创建文件的测试准备; 总结测试结论:Linux普通文件的读、写、执行权限说明 有关文件删除的说明 原理示意图:
阅读全文
posted @
2019-09-27 10:16
Jiekon
阅读(150)
推荐(0)
Linux文件权限基础回顾介绍
摘要:文件的权限 文件权限的概述: 权限贯穿运维的一生
阅读全文
posted @
2019-09-26 14:17
Jiekon
阅读(116)
推荐(0)
Linux命令---ln、readlink
摘要:ln 无参数 创建硬链接 -s 创建软链接 用法:ln [option] 源文件 目标文件 只有在同一块磁盘上,inode值一样的,才是同一文件。 创建软链接: readlink 用于查看软链接文件的源文件 rename 文件重命名工具 用法: rename from to file from 代表
阅读全文
posted @
2019-09-26 11:06
Jiekon
阅读(2028)
推荐(2)
Linux三剑客之sed深度实践讲解(下)
摘要:2.3.4分组替换 \( \) 和\1的使用说明 2.3.5 特殊符号 &代表被替换的内容 2.4 查 p 输出指定内容,但默认会输出2次匹配的结果,因此,使用n取消默认输出。 2.4.1 按行查询 一般来说,用sed取行是最简单的。 2.4.2 按字符串查询 2.4.3 混合查询
阅读全文
posted @
2019-09-25 17:56
Jiekon
阅读(189)
推荐(0)
Linux三剑客之sed深度实践讲解(上)
摘要:sed sed 是Stream Editor(流编辑器)缩写,是操 作过滤和转换文本内容的强大工具。常用功能有增删改查,过滤,取行。 2、增删改查 2.1 增 a 追加文本到指定行后 i 插入文本到指定行前 2.12 多行增加 2.2删 d 删除指定的行 2.3 改 2.3.1 按行替换 c 用新行
阅读全文
posted @
2019-09-25 11:17
Jiekon
阅读(290)
推荐(0)
Linux第三阶段题型测试
摘要:1、如何取得/etiantian文件的权限对应的数字内容,如-rw-r--r--为644,要求使用命令取得644或0644这样的数字。 解答: 1)最土的方法:ls -l /etiantian |cut -c2-10|tr "rwx-" "4210"|awk -F "" '{print $1+$2+
阅读全文
posted @
2019-09-23 17:28
Jiekon
阅读(200)
推荐(0)
Linux正则表达式题型
摘要:1.将下面的/etc/passwd所有行的第一列和最后一列相互调换位置。 解答: 1)使用sed的后向引用 2)awk -F ":" '{print $7":"$6":"$5":"$4":"$3":"$2":"$1}' /etc/passwd
阅读全文
posted @
2019-09-22 13:57
Jiekon
阅读(204)
推荐(0)
linux文本处理三剑客命令及用法
摘要:grep:文本过滤工具 功能说明: sed :字符流编辑器 功能说明: awk :
阅读全文
posted @
2019-09-22 13:12
Jiekon
阅读(238)
推荐(0)
Linux操作系统原理笔记
摘要:在Linux操作系统内核内部,进程是通过一个链表,而且是一个双向链表来管理的。 进程描述符:每一个进程都有其描述符,每一个描述符彼此之间都有关联性的。 双向链表: 一个进程内部可能包含多个线程。 上下文切换(Context swtch) 假如说进程A从当前CPU上被拿走,切换成进程B,进程A有自己的
阅读全文
posted @
2019-09-14 21:58
Jiekon
阅读(1550)
推荐(0)
计算机及操作系统原理笔记
摘要:CPU :运算器、 控制器、寄存器。(三大核心部件) RAM :内存设备 一个字节为一个存储单元 cell NorthBridge : 32bit 2^32=4GB 32位的CPU最多只能理解4G的物理内存空间 64bit 4GB*4GB CPU (线路复用)寻址 RAM PAE: 物理地址扩展(p
阅读全文
posted @
2019-09-13 15:04
Jiekon
阅读(444)
推荐(0)
Linux正则表达式结合三剑客企业级实战
摘要:1、取系统ip 解答: 1)ifconfig ens33 |sed -n '2p'|sed "s#inet##g"|sed 's#n.*$##g' 2)ifconfig ens33 |sed -n '2s#inet##gp'|sed 's# n.*$##g' sed的后向引用; sed -n 's#
阅读全文
posted @
2019-09-11 15:12
Jiekon
阅读(174)
推荐(0)
Linux正则表达式扩展部分第一波深度实践详解
摘要:扩展的正则表达式(Extended Regular Expressions): 使用的命令:grep -E 以及 egrep 【了解即可】 1)+ 表示重复”一个或一个以上“ 前面的字符(*是0或多个) 2)?表示重复”0个或一个“前面的字符(.是有且只有一个) 3)| 表示同时过滤多个字符串 4)
阅读全文
posted @
2019-09-11 10:20
Jiekon
阅读(181)
推荐(0)
Linux三剑客之grep常用参数详细总结
摘要:三剑客grep总结 grep : Linux三剑客老三 过滤需要的内容 参数: grep一般常用参数: -a :在二进制文件中,以文本文件的方式搜索数据 -c :计算找到 ’ 搜索字符串 ‘ 的次数 -o :仅显示出匹配regexp的内容(用于统计出现在文中的次数) -i :忽略大小写的不同,所以大
阅读全文
posted @
2019-09-11 09:04
Jiekon
阅读(854)
推荐(0)
典型操作系统的架构
摘要:典型操作系统架构 WINDOWS操作系统的体系结构 简化图 LINUX操作系统
阅读全文
posted @
2019-09-10 16:46
Jiekon
阅读(2223)
推荐(0)
操作系统原理
摘要:操作系统做了什么 以一个简单的C语言程序为例: 下面是操作系统对程序的运行过程: 操作系统是什么? 操作系统是计算机系统中的一个系统软件,是一些程序模块的集合 1) 它们能以尽量有效、合理的方式组合和管理计算机的软硬资源 2) 合理地组织计算机的工作流程,控制程序的执行并向用户提供各种服务功能 3)
阅读全文
posted @
2019-09-10 16:22
Jiekon
阅读(2503)
推荐(1)
Linux三剑客正则表达式
摘要:恢复内容开始 一、什么是正则表达式? 简单的说,正则表达式就是为处理大量的字符串而定义的一套规则和方法。 例如:假设”@“代表dongdaxia,” ! “代表dongxiaoxia 。 echo ”@!“ ” dongdaxiadongxiaoxia“ 通过定义的这些特殊符号的辅助,系统管理员就可
阅读全文
posted @
2019-09-07 11:04
Jiekon
阅读(356)
推荐(0)
Linux通配符知识深度实践详解
摘要:注意:linux通配符和三剑客(grep、awk、sed)正则表达式是不一样的,因此,代表的意义也有较大的区别。 通配符一般用户命令行bash环境,而Linux正则表达式用于grep、sed、awk场景。 * 代表所有(0到多个)字符***** ? 通配符,代表1个字符 ; 连续不同命令的分隔符**
阅读全文
posted @
2019-09-06 10:58
Jiekon
阅读(220)
推荐(0)
Linux文件属性之时间戳及文件名知识详解
摘要:7、8、9三列是时间(默认是修改时间) modify 修改时间 mtime 一般是修改文件内容 change 改变时间 ctime 文件的属性改变 access 访问时间 atime 访问文件内容 显示全部时间 格式化显示时间属性: 第10列 文件名 不在文件 inode里,而是在上级目录的bloc
阅读全文
posted @
2019-09-06 09:18
Jiekon
阅读(860)
推荐(0)
Linux文件属性之用户和组基础知识介绍
摘要:一、Linux多用户多任务介绍 Linux/Unix 是一个多用户、多任务的操作系统:在讲Linux账号及账号组管理之前,我们先简单了解多用户、多任务操作系统的基本概念。 1.1Linux单用户多任务 2)Linux系统中用户角色划分 超级用户: 默认是root用户,其UID和GID均为0.root
阅读全文
posted @
2019-09-05 20:39
Jiekon
阅读(411)
推荐(0)
企业案例-文件删除企业生产故障模拟重现(未完成待续)
摘要:问题:硬盘显示被写满,但是用du -sh /* 查看时占用硬盘空间之和还远小于硬盘大小。即找不到硬盘分区是怎么被写满的。 df -h(查看磁盘大小) fdisk -l (查看总分区) 查看总分去,发现有146G 然后 du -sh /* 把所有目录加起来却远不到146G,所以中间肯定有一些看不见的东
阅读全文
posted @
2019-09-05 11:18
Jiekon
阅读(164)
推荐(0)
Linux文件属性之Linux文件删除重要原理详解
摘要:Linux下文件删除的原理 只要dongdaxiafile(源文件)、服务进程、dongdaxiaflie_hard_link(硬链接文件)三个中的任意一个存在文件不会被删除。
阅读全文
posted @
2019-09-04 20:08
Jiekon
阅读(210)
推荐(0)
Linux文件属性之软硬连接知识深度详解
摘要:一、链接的概念 在Linux系统中,链接可分为两种;一种为硬链接(Hard Link),另一个位软连接或符号链接(Symbolic Link or link)。我们在前面讲解过ln这个命令就是创建链接文件的,在默认不带参数的情况下,执行ln命令创建的链接是硬链接。 如果使用ln -s 创建链接则为软
阅读全文
posted @
2019-09-04 17:35
Jiekon
阅读(1212)
推荐(0)
Linux文件权限基础知识
摘要:一、文件权限概述 Linux中每个文件或目录都有一组一组9个基础权限位,每三位字符被分为一组,他们分别是属主权限位(占三个字符)、用户组权限位(占三个字符)、其他用户权限位(占三个字符)。比如rwxr-xr-x,在linux中正是这9个权限(更多权限位后面会提到)位来控制文件属主、用户组以及其他用户
阅读全文
posted @
2019-09-03 17:43
Jiekon
阅读(202)
推荐(0)
Linux文件属性拓展知识
摘要:文件删除恢复ext3grep,应该多养成好习惯,先备份在操作;要能快速还原,不容易还原,先通过多套测试环境测试,然后在操作。 企业面试题: 一个100M(100000K)的磁盘分区,分别写入1K的文件或写入1M的文件,分别可以写多少个? 解答: 这道题不需计算,只须答出以下知识点: 企业案例: 一、
阅读全文
posted @
2019-09-03 16:22
Jiekon
阅读(409)
推荐(0)
Linux 文件和目录的属性及权限
摘要:一、Linux中的文件 1.1文件属性概述 Linux里一切皆文件! Linux系统中的文件或目录的属性主要包括;索引节点(inode)、文件类型、权限属性、链接数、所归属的用户组、最近修改时间等内容; 文件名不算文件的属性。 二、索引节点 inode 2.1 inode 概述 硬盘要分区,然后格式
阅读全文
posted @
2019-09-02 16:57
Jiekon
阅读(321)
推荐(0)
linux优化之优化开机自启动服务
摘要:精简开机系统启动 和Windows系统一样,在linux服务器运行过程中,会有很多无用的软件默认就在运行,这些服务占用了很多系统资源,而且也带来了安全隐患,因此要关闭掉。那么,企业生产场景的linux主机到底需要保留哪些开机启动的服务呢? 1)重要的开机自启动服务 企业环境新装Linux系统之后有必
阅读全文
posted @
2019-09-01 13:38
Jiekon
阅读(565)
推荐(0)